PM condemns Malegaon blasts, appeals for calm

New Delhi, Sep 8: Condeming the Malegaon terror attack, Prime Minister Manmohan Singh today appealed for peace and communal harmony and urged the people to remain calm.

The Prime Minister has been kept appraised by the Union Home Ministry and Maharashtra Chief Minister Vilasrao Deshmukh about the blasts, a PMO spokesman said.

Investigations into the incidents were on and relief and medical help was being provided to the injured, he said.
